Hundred days of war in Ukraine, Queen's Platinum Jubilee, Verdict in Depp-Heard trial

What can stop Russia's offensive in eastern Ukraine? François Picard's panel weighs in on the impact of Western sanctions on Moscow and the world economy. Also on the show: Britain holds Platinum Jubilee celebrations to mark Queen Elizabeth II's 70 years on the throne. On the other side of the Atlantic, the verdict in the Johnny Depp-Amber Heard trial raises many questions about online hate.

Our goal is to create a safe and engaging place for users to connect over interests and passions. In order to improve our community experience, we are temporarily suspending article commenting